Filing deadline is Friday for May 15 primary

| March 5, 2012 8:00 PM

Kootenai County has released list of candidates who have filed during the first week for a variety of county offices and precinct committee positions.

"It's still early; only half the filing timeline has passed," said county clerk Cliff Hayes. "This picture is continuing to evolve, and it will change further over the next week."

Some races aren't very active so far. Only incumbents Barry McHugh for Prosecuting Attorney and Dan Green for Commissioner District 3 have filed, and are without challengers.

Other races have several challengers, notably Commissioner District 1, with 4 challengers. For sheriff, three candidates have filed with a party affiliation, and their names will appear on the May ballot.

One independent candidate has also filed for sheriff, but under Idaho Code 34-708, his name will appear only on the November ballot. For Precinct Committeemen, 30 Republican candidates have filed, and five Democratic candidates.
